Whether you can vape or not while your device is charging depends on a few factors. Some vape kits have 'pass-through technology', which means the device can be used while it's on charge. Some examples of devices which have this feature are the Innokin Endura T20-S, the blu Ace and the Joyetech eGo AIO D22.

Even if they did, I wouldn't recommend it. They discharge and recharge the batteries at the same time. Batteries get warm while charging, and even warmer while discharging. Even if the mod could do it, I woldn't recommend it because it decreases the lifespan of your batteries. That is why I buy extra batteries, and swap them out when they get low.

What does R mean on a battery?

The “R” just means rechargeable. The “AW” on some batteries is initials for Andrew Wan, who owns a China-based company which purchases large quantities of batteries from the big boys (Samsung, Panasonic, etc.) and performs quality tests on each one.

Can you use a Li-FePO4 battery with a Li-Ion charger?

Most have a working voltage much lower than the Li-Ion equivalent and they cannot be used with Li-Ion chargers.
